He was talking about TNBC- (Teen NBC.) TNBC was a saturday morning time-block that aired sitcoms geared to teenagers. TNBC last until last year, and it was replaced by Discovery Kids on NBC.

The only one from your list that qualifies is "Saved By The Bell."
